64位內核第一講,和32位內核的區別 雙擊調試配置請查看 連接: https://www.cnblogs.com/aliflycoris/p/5877323.html 一丶編譯的區別. 首先,還是使用WDK7.1.7600編寫. 但是編譯的時候,要使用x64來編譯 ...
Windows內核開發 位和 位的區別 位的應用程序可以完美再 位的電腦上運行,而 位的內核驅動無法再 位的電腦上運行,或者 位的驅動無法在 位的應用程序上運行。這是為什么呢。 原因是在x 的Windows操作系統上,模擬了x 操作系統的操作,並且引入了一個WOW 子系統,將x 和x 完美進行兼容。 WOW 子系統 x 能在x 上運行全靠這個東西。全名叫做Windows On Windows,英文 ...
2021-10-19 21:17 2 758 推薦指數:
64位內核第一講,和32位內核的區別 雙擊調試配置請查看 連接: https://www.cnblogs.com/aliflycoris/p/5877323.html 一丶編譯的區別. 首先,還是使用WDK7.1.7600編寫. 但是編譯的時候,要使用x64來編譯 ...
Tips : 這篇文章的主題是x86及x64 windows系統下的inline hook實現部分。 32位inline hook 對於系統API的hook,windows 系統為了達成hotpatch的目的,每個API函數的最前5個字節均為: 8bff move edi ...
openssl版本:openssl-1.0.0k 64位編譯 1、編譯環境:openssl-1.0.0a必須用vs2008編譯(Open Visual Studio 2008 x64 Cross Tools Command Prompt),VC6+nasm32是無法編譯 ...
操作系統只是硬件和應用軟件中間的一個平台。 32位操作系統針對的32位的CPU設計。 64位操作系統針對的64位的CPU設計。操作系統只是硬件和應用軟件中間的一個平台。 32位操作系統針對的32位的CPU設計。 64位操作系統針對的64位的CPU設計 ...
印象最深的是,我用64位的ida 去分析一個32位的附件 ,這就是我弄了五天都沒能把反匯編的代碼用f5表示出來,,果然像學長說的一樣,自己多踩坑,就會印象深刻,現在真的是,難忘啊,我想我應該會記得很久的,, 這就要說到 在虛擬機里面下載好了gdb 之后自帶的 checkset 來分析 ...
openssl版本:openssl-1.0.1h 64位編譯 1、編譯環境:openssl-1.0.0a必須用vs2008編譯(Open Visual Studio 2008 x64 Cross Tools Command Prompt),VC6+nasm32是無法編譯 ...
我有一個配置挺好的電腦,win10 64位的系統,但是最近下載的一個軟件用着巨慢,導致我嚴重想知道下載的軟件是64位的還是32位的 百度谷歌了很久,大多數都說是兩個方法: 1. 判斷文件的安裝路徑,如果是安裝在“Program Files (x86)”下的就是32位,在“Program ...
本文已經收錄至我的GitHub,歡迎大家踴躍star 和 issues。 https://github.com/midou-tech/articles 通過前面兩篇文章的學 ...